<?xml version="1.0" encoding="UTF-8"?><rss x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:atom="http://www.w3.org/2005/Atom" version="2.0"><channel><title><![CDATA[Datenbankanbindung via DSN (Access mdb)]]></title><description><![CDATA[<p>Guten Tag,</p>
<p>ich habe bisher viele hilfreiche Antworten in diesem Forum gefunden.<br />
Vielen Dank dafür.</p>
<p>Nun bin ich jedoch auf ein Problem gestossen an dem ich seit Tagen sitze ohne Erfolg.</p>
<p>ich programmiere: C++-Application<br />
ich benutze: VS6.0, Access.mdb</p>
<p>die Access.mdb habe ich als ODBC-Datenquelle (DSN) eingerichtet.<br />
(kein benutzer und pswd.)</p>
<p>Hier ein Auszug aus meinem Code:</p>
<pre><code class="language-cpp">m_pConn.CreateInstance(__uuidof(Connection));

//m_pConn-&gt;Open(L&quot;Provider=MSDASQL.1;Data Source=CPM.mdb&quot;, &quot;&quot;, &quot;&quot;, adOpenUnspecified);

m_pConn-&gt;Open(L&quot;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\\Dokumente und Einstellungen\\user\\Eigene Dateien\\CPM\\CPM.mdb;Persist Security Info=False&quot;,&quot;&quot;,&quot;&quot;,adOpenUnspecified);
</code></pre>
<p>wie hier zu sehen ist habe ich 2 &quot;Open&quot;-Möglichkeiten. Beide funktionieren.<br />
Jedoch habe ich festgestellt das mein SQL-Statement nicht sql-konform sein darf, sondern Access-konform sein muss.<br />
Bsp:ein Datum muss mit: #01.01.2007# im Statement eingebaut werden (die Raute meine ich).</p>
<p>Ich vermute das der &quot;Provider&quot;-Teil in m_pConn-&gt;Open nicht wirklich richtig ist.</p>
<p>Hat jemand einen Verbesserungsvorschlag?</p>
]]></description><link>https://www.c-plusplus.net/forum/topic/178473/datenbankanbindung-via-dsn-access-mdb</link><generator>RSS for Node</generator><lastBuildDate>Sun, 19 Apr 2026 07:02:35 GMT</lastBuildDate><atom:link href="https://www.c-plusplus.net/forum/topic/178473.rss" rel="self" type="application/rss+xml"/><pubDate>Wed, 11 Apr 2007 14:50:57 GMT</pubDate><ttl>60</ttl><item><title><![CDATA[Reply to Datenbankanbindung via DSN (Access mdb) on Wed, 11 Apr 2007 14:50:57 GMT]]></title><description><![CDATA[<p>Guten Tag,</p>
<p>ich habe bisher viele hilfreiche Antworten in diesem Forum gefunden.<br />
Vielen Dank dafür.</p>
<p>Nun bin ich jedoch auf ein Problem gestossen an dem ich seit Tagen sitze ohne Erfolg.</p>
<p>ich programmiere: C++-Application<br />
ich benutze: VS6.0, Access.mdb</p>
<p>die Access.mdb habe ich als ODBC-Datenquelle (DSN) eingerichtet.<br />
(kein benutzer und pswd.)</p>
<p>Hier ein Auszug aus meinem Code:</p>
<pre><code class="language-cpp">m_pConn.CreateInstance(__uuidof(Connection));

//m_pConn-&gt;Open(L&quot;Provider=MSDASQL.1;Data Source=CPM.mdb&quot;, &quot;&quot;, &quot;&quot;, adOpenUnspecified);

m_pConn-&gt;Open(L&quot;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\\Dokumente und Einstellungen\\user\\Eigene Dateien\\CPM\\CPM.mdb;Persist Security Info=False&quot;,&quot;&quot;,&quot;&quot;,adOpenUnspecified);
</code></pre>
<p>wie hier zu sehen ist habe ich 2 &quot;Open&quot;-Möglichkeiten. Beide funktionieren.<br />
Jedoch habe ich festgestellt das mein SQL-Statement nicht sql-konform sein darf, sondern Access-konform sein muss.<br />
Bsp:ein Datum muss mit: #01.01.2007# im Statement eingebaut werden (die Raute meine ich).</p>
<p>Ich vermute das der &quot;Provider&quot;-Teil in m_pConn-&gt;Open nicht wirklich richtig ist.</p>
<p>Hat jemand einen Verbesserungsvorschlag?</p>
]]></description><link>https://www.c-plusplus.net/forum/post/1263893</link><guid isPermaLink="true">https://www.c-plusplus.net/forum/post/1263893</guid><dc:creator><![CDATA[Darweis]]></dc:creator><pubDate>Wed, 11 Apr 2007 14:50:57 GMT</pubDate></item><item><title><![CDATA[Reply to Datenbankanbindung via DSN (Access mdb) on Thu, 12 Apr 2007 08:29:32 GMT]]></title><description><![CDATA[<p>Dieser Thread wurde von Moderator/in <a href="http://www.c-plusplus.net/forum/profile-var-mode-is-viewprofile-and-u-is-403.html" rel="nofollow">HumeSikkins</a> aus dem Forum <a href="http://www.c-plusplus.net/forum/viewforum-var-f-is-15.html" rel="nofollow">C++</a> in das Forum <a href="http://www.c-plusplus.net/forum/viewforum-var-f-is-1.html" rel="nofollow">MFC (Visual C++)</a> verschoben.</p>
<p>Im Zweifelsfall bitte auch folgende Hinweise beachten:<br />
<a href="http://www.c-plusplus.net/forum/viewtopic-var-t-is-39405.html" rel="nofollow">C/C++ Forum :: FAQ - Sonstiges :: Wohin mit meiner Frage?</a></p>
<p><em>Dieses Posting wurde automatisch erzeugt.</em></p>
]]></description><link>https://www.c-plusplus.net/forum/post/1264397</link><guid isPermaLink="true">https://www.c-plusplus.net/forum/post/1264397</guid><dc:creator><![CDATA[C++ Forumbot]]></dc:creator><pubDate>Thu, 12 Apr 2007 08:29:32 GMT</pubDate></item></channel></rss>